Pin code 314036 belongs to Dungarpur district in Rajasthan, India. This pin code is served by 13 post offices, with Asela (Branch Office) as the primary office. It falls under the Ajmer postal region, Dungarpur division, and Rajasthan postal circle.

What Does Pin Code 314036 Mean?

Every Indian PIN code is a 6-digit number where each digit carries a specific meaning. Here's how 314036 breaks down:

Digit Position Value What It Represents
1st digit — Postal Zone 3 Western region of India
2nd digit — Sub-zone 1 Sub-region within Rajasthan
3rd digit — Sorting District 4 Dungarpur sorting district
Last 3 digits — Post Office 036 Asela (B.O)

The first digit 3 places this pincode in the Western postal zone. The combination 31 narrows it to a sub-region within Rajasthan, while 314 identifies the Dungarpur sorting district. The final three digits 036 point to the specific delivery post office — Asela.
